Can I have more than 6 people?

No, the max we can take is 6 passengers, whether they are fishing or not. This is not our rule, it is how the U.S. Coast Guard licenses private charters. Most private charters operate under this type of licensing. If you have more than 6 people, you can charter more than one boat. If you have a large group please do not let this deter you. We will work with other trusted captains to accommodate your needs.

What if I get seasick? 

We suggest that you take a motion sickness medicine (we suggest Dramamine) with your evening meal the night before and with a light breakfast the morning of the trip to avert seasickness. But, there are some individuals who will still get seasick even doing so. In the event your seasickness is intolerable, we will cut the trip short and return to dock. The captain will let you make the call.

Can we bring alcohol? 

Yes. If you choose to drink we ask that you please be responsible. All alcohol must come in plastic or aluminum. No Glass.For the safety of everyone onboard the captain reserves the right to terminate a charter and return to the dock if a passenger becomes disorderly.

Can I bring my own fishing gear? 

Yes you may but we prefer to have you to use our gear. We have taken the time to select and rig our gear to the specific type of fishing we are doing and to maximize success. Please let your captain know ahead of time if you plan on bringing any of your own fishing equipment so that everyone can be best prepared for the trip.
